Fencing Styles: An Introduction to Different Schools

Fencing, a sport steeped in history and elegance, employs three distinct weapon styles: foil, épée, and sabre. Each style presents a unique set of strategies.

The foil is characterized by its emphasis on finesse, targeting the opponent's torso with light, rapid thrusts. In contrast, the epee offers a more direct approach, allowing attacks to the entire body. Sabre fencing, known for its speed, facilitates dynamic movements and slashing cuts.
